According to an article published October 11‚ 2016‚ Wells Fargo Bank has had substantial ethical and fraudulent issues for several years (Cowley‚ 2016). There are reports of misuse in reporting and fraudulent activity dating back to the year 2005. A Los Angeles city attorney filed a lawsuit against Wells Fargo in May 2015 (Cowley‚ 2016). Global beer market trends The global beer market1 At the turn of the century‚ the top 10 brewers accounted for just over one-third of global beer sales volumes. The past decade has seen a rapid consolidation‚ resulting in the top four brewers – Anheuser-Busch InBev‚ SABMiller‚ Heineken and Carlsberg – accounting for almost 50% of beer sales volumes and up to 75% of the global profit pool2. Because Guantanamo Bay is completely controlled by the U.S. but not actually a part of the United States‚ laws including any regarding human rights ceased to apply there (Friedman 82). According to Ardiente‚ this may be what justified military personnel or others working there to interrogate the way they did. Military doctors have admitted to giving information about detainees’ mental health in order to use it for cooperation of manipulation; the Pentagon has denied such claims (Ardiente 2).

Hooters Current Ethical Issue Over the years the national chain restaurant Hooters has had lawsuits brought against them for discrimination based on gender. Currently‚ the issue is weight discrimination. Not just one lawsuit‚ but two‚ and maybe three lawsuits may be filed. The waitresses claim that they lost their jobs because they weighed too much.
